Shopping

Arezzo offers a delightful shopping experience with local boutiques and markets. If you're up for a drive, the Valdichiana Outlet Village, located 10.6km away, is great for family shopping, while The Mall Luxury Outlet, 16.8km away, features luxury brands. For unique finds, visit RI Crea RE, 18.0km from Arezzo.

Recreation

At Villa a Sesta Polo Club, indulge in a luxurious retreat surrounded by picturesque landscapes, perfect for relaxation. Terme di Chianciano offers rejuvenating spa treatments, while San Giovanni Terme Rapolano provides soothing body therapies, ensuring a delightful wellness experience just a short drive from Arezzo.

Adventure

At Saltalbero Adventure Park, experience the thrill of ziplining and navigating ropes courses, all surrounded by stunning outdoor vibes. For a scenic adventure, embark on Hannibal's Journey hiking trail, offering breathtaking views. For speed enthusiasts, the Siena Circuit karting track promises an exhilarating race, complete with adventure vibes.

Nightlife

Arezzo boasts a vibrant nightlife with the historic Petrarca Theater, perfect for culture and romance. For film lovers, UCI Cinemas Arezzo offers family-friendly entertainment. If you're up for an adventure, head to CarpegnaPark, just 19.3km away, for a thrilling arcade experience.

Best time to go to Arezzo

The best time to visit Arezzo is dependant on what kind of holiday you are seeking. July is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is sunny with no rain (dry). January is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ly low and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January39.2°F (4.0°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owAverage
February41.2°F (5.1°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owSlightly Low
March46.0°F (7.8°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
April52.7°F (11.5°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ighAverage
May59.5°F (15.3°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
June69.1°F (20.6°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High
July74.8°F (23.8°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nySlightly HighSlightly High
August74.5°F (23.6°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nyAverageSlightly High
September65.7°F (18.7°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ighAverage
October56.8°F (13.8°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owAverage
November48.6°F (9.2°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
December41.7°F (5.4°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age

Where can I find the best nightlife in Arezzo?
Arezzo, a charming city in Tuscany, is not only known for its rich history and stunning architecture but also offers a delightful nightlife scene that captures the essence of Italian culture.

The historic centre of Arezzo is where you'll find a variety of bars and eateries that come alive in the evenings. Corso Italia, the main street, is lined with numerous cafes and wine bars, superb for enjoying a glass of local Chianti while people-watching.

For a more vibrant atmosphere, head to Piazza Grande, where you can find a few lively spots that often host live music events or themed nights, particularly during weekends. This square, steeped in history, becomes a social hub as the sun sets, inviting locals and visitors alike to mingle and enjoy the evening air.

If you're in the mood for dancing, check out some of the local clubs in the outskirts of the city that cater to various music tastes, from dance to live rock. These venues often feature both local and international DJs, ensuring an entertaining night out.
